Role Description The Administrative Coordinator is a full-time, on-site role based in Saida El Oustani. The role involves managing day-to-day administrative tasks, including preparing and organizing documents, handling correspondence, maintaining records, and supporting office operations. The Administrative Coordinator will coordinate meetings and schedules, assist in basic finance-related activities such as tracking invoices or expenses, and support internal and external customer inquiries in a professional manner. The role also includes collaborating with team members, ensuring timely follow-up on requests, and maintaining orderly filing and office systems. This position requires consistent on-site presence to support smooth office workflow and provide direct support to management and staff.
